Class IdentityProviderConfigBuilder
- java.lang.Object
-
- io.fabric8.kubernetes.api.builder.BaseFluent<A>
-
- io.fabric8.openshift.api.model.config.v1.IdentityProviderConfigFluent<IdentityProviderConfigBuilder>
-
- io.fabric8.openshift.api.model.config.v1.IdentityProviderConfigBuilder
-
- All Implemented Interfaces:
io.fabric8.kubernetes.api.builder.Builder<IdentityProviderConfig>,io.fabric8.kubernetes.api.builder.Visitable<IdentityProviderConfigBuilder>,io.fabric8.kubernetes.api.builder.VisitableBuilder<IdentityProviderConfig,IdentityProviderConfigBuilder>
public class IdentityProviderConfigBuilder extends IdentityProviderConfigFluent<IdentityProviderConfigBuilder> implements io.fabric8.kubernetes.api.builder.VisitableBuilder<IdentityProviderConfig,IdentityProviderConfigBuilder>
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from class io.fabric8.openshift.api.model.config.v1.IdentityProviderConfigFluent
IdentityProviderConfigFluent.BasicAuthNested<N>, IdentityProviderConfigFluent.GithubNested<N>, IdentityProviderConfigFluent.GitlabNested<N>, IdentityProviderConfigFluent.GoogleNested<N>, IdentityProviderConfigFluent.HtpasswdNested<N>, IdentityProviderConfigFluent.KeystoneNested<N>, IdentityProviderConfigFluent.LdapNested<N>, IdentityProviderConfigFluent.OpenIDNested<N>, IdentityProviderConfigFluent.RequestHeaderNested<N>
-
-
Constructor Summary
Constructors Constructor Description IdentityProviderConfigBuilder()IdentityProviderConfigBuilder(IdentityProviderConfig instance)IdentityProviderConfigBuilder(IdentityProviderConfigFluent<?> fluent)IdentityProviderConfigBuilder(IdentityProviderConfigFluent<?> fluent, IdentityProviderConfig instance)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description IdentityProviderConfigbuild()-
Methods inherited from class io.fabric8.openshift.api.model.config.v1.IdentityProviderConfigFluent
addToAdditionalProperties, addToAdditionalProperties, buildBasicAuth, buildGithub, buildGitlab, buildGoogle, buildHtpasswd, buildKeystone, buildLdap, buildOpenID, buildRequestHeader, copyInstance, editBasicAuth, editGithub, editGitlab, editGoogle, editHtpasswd, editKeystone, editLdap, editOpenID, editOrNewBasicAuth, editOrNewBasicAuthLike, editOrNewGithub, editOrNewGithubLike, editOrNewGitlab, editOrNewGitlabLike, editOrNewGoogle, editOrNewGoogleLike, editOrNewHtpasswd, editOrNewHtpasswdLike, editOrNewKeystone, editOrNewKeystoneLike, editOrNewLdap, editOrNewLdapLike, editOrNewOpenID, editOrNewOpenIDLike, editOrNewRequestHeader, editOrNewRequestHeaderLike, editRequestHeader, equals, getAdditionalProperties, getType, hasAdditionalProperties, hasBasicAuth, hasGithub, hasGitlab, hasGoogle, hashCode, hasHtpasswd, hasKeystone, hasLdap, hasOpenID, hasRequestHeader, hasType, removeFromAdditionalProperties, removeFromAdditionalProperties, toString, withAdditionalProperties, withBasicAuth, withGithub, withGitlab, withGoogle, withHtpasswd, withKeystone, withLdap, withNewBasicAuth, withNewBasicAuthLike, withNewGithub, withNewGithubLike, withNewGitlab, withNewGitlabLike, withNewGoogle, withNewGoogleLike, withNewHtpasswd, withNewHtpasswdLike, withNewKeystone, withNewKeystoneLike, withNewLdap, withNewLdapLike, withNewOpenID, withNewOpenIDLike, withNewRequestHeader, withNewRequestHeaderLike, withOpenID, withRequestHeader, withType
-
Methods inherited from class io.fabric8.kubernetes.api.builder.BaseFluent
aggregate, aggregate, build, build, builderOf, getVisitableMap
-
-
-
-
Constructor Detail
-
IdentityProviderConfigBuilder
public IdentityProviderConfigBuilder()
-
IdentityProviderConfigBuilder
public IdentityProviderConfigBuilder(IdentityProviderConfigFluent<?> fluent)
-
IdentityProviderConfigBuilder
public IdentityProviderConfigBuilder(IdentityProviderConfigFluent<?> fluent, IdentityProviderConfig instance)
-
IdentityProviderConfigBuilder
public IdentityProviderConfigBuilder(IdentityProviderConfig instance)
-
-
Method Detail
-
build
public IdentityProviderConfig build()
- Specified by:
buildin interfaceio.fabric8.kubernetes.api.builder.Builder<IdentityProviderConfig>
-
-